Oteil Burbridge & Friends continued their tour in support of the Dead & Company/Allman Brothers Band bassist’s new album, Lovely View of Heaven, at The Strand Ballroom in Providence, RI on Friday, but the all-star band comprised of Jason Crosby, Duane Betts, Steve and John Kimock, Melvin Seals, and Lamar Williams Jr. didn’t confine themselves to just the Jerry Garcia/Robert Hunter ballads featured on the album.
The band opened with “Play It Back” by late organ master Dr. Lonnie Smith before shuffling a mix of tunes from throughout Oteil’s illustrious career, including tunes from his Oteil & the Peacemakers days, and covers of the Dead, Allman Brothers Band, and Bob Dylan‘s “Knockin’ On Heaven’s Door”. Duane Betts took the lead on his song “Waiting on a Song”, and Jason Crosby displayed his many talents during “Friend of the Lithium Devil”, which heard the multi-instrumentalist sing lyrics from “Friend of the Devil” to the music of Nirvana‘s “Lithium” in addition to playing electric piano and fiddle. Crosby has played the creative mashup with different projects over the years, including Phil Lesh & The Terrapin Family Band. Check out fan-shot footage of the song below.
